Position Overview – Senior Medical Science Liaison As an integral member of the ecosystem team for Otsuka’s ecosystem-based customer engagement model, the Senior Medical Science Liaison (MSL), contributes to the development of the ecosystem strategic business plan and identifies key stakeholders that are vital to the ecosystem. The Senior MSL is a credible partner responsible for providing clinical, scientific and health economic information related to nephrology and immunology disease states and the appropriate utilization of approved Otsuka products within an ecosystem. This field-based position will engage with Key Influencers (KIs), Local Practice Leaders (LPLs), healthcare providers, and patients’ groups within their ecosystem, to further patient outcomes aligned with the overarching objectives of Otsuka. In collaboration with their ecosystem partners, MSLs contribute to the customization of the region business strategy to meet local ecosystem needs and are responsible for the medical and educational requirements of their customers. In addition, MSLs may be responsible for covering multiple products within a therapeutic area, as well as engaging in broad clinical and scientific discussions that impact patient care, resulting in rich customer insights shared within the ecosystem. Key Activities and Responsibilities As part of the ecosystem team, contributes a clinical and scientific perspective to the local execution plan that addresses customer challenges, issues, and opportunities, to bring about improved patient care and outcomes. This extends to include coordination around execution of field activities. Build, cultivate, and leverage external relationships with key scientific and medical customers and organizations within their territory to ensure strong understanding of evolving healthcare trends, disease state, Otsuka products, systems, and services across the ecosystem landscape, including KIs, LPLs, Key Decision Makers (KDMs) and Patient Advocacy. Delivers on business objectives that go beyond their territory and impacts the Medical Affairs organization. Maintains a deep and comprehensive understanding of the ecosystem to ensure alignment with Otsuka’s patient-centric strategy and priorities, including provision and delivery of optimal patient care. To be a credible source of evidence-based information that demonstrates the value of Otsuka and its products from the clinical, economic, and humanistic standpoint and works in partnership with providers, and other key stakeholders to apply practical real-world solutions to improve patient outcomes. Engages stakeholders at the local level that has some influence across the region. Build and cultivate important internal working relationships across the matrix team to ensure an enterprise approach when working with customers. Be accountable to regional Field Medical Affairs (FMA) leadership to shape and execute on local medical strategies within planned timelines. Leads special projects as requested by management and takes on incremental point roles within FMA. Disseminate disease state and healthcare landscape information to customers in the field as defined by priorities. Responsible for clinical and data focused training of promotional and disease state speakers. May serve as part of Otsuka’s speaker bureau in support of product educational needs across the territory. Collect and submit medical insights that drive decision making and prioritization of evidence generation efforts and healthcare solutions, including sharing at the local ecosystem level. Assist with Otsuka’s clinical trials program, including registrational, post‑marketing and Investigator‑Sponsored Trials (ISTs), health economic outcomes research, other specific medical collaborations; provide clinical expertise and feedback regarding operational management of clinical trials to ensure optimal site selection and performance. Participates as mentor in peer functional and therapeutic development including new hires. Support other areas of the organization including Safety & Pharmacovigilance for investigation of safety‑related issues, Sales Training medical education on an ongoing basis including new hire and POAs, and the Field Medical Center of Excellence for mentoring and sharing of best practices.
